We give a brief review of integration methods of relativistic wave equations in curved spaces. On the basis of a non-commutative integration method we give an exact solution of Dirac and Klein-Gordon-Fock equations in a four-dimensional Ricci flat manifold admitting a second Dirac operator. Some analytical properties of the solutions are studied. We compare spectra of spin and scalar particles as well. A visual model of the supersymmetry structure which arises is considered and the physical sense of the second Dirac operator is explained.
